How to Make Cheesy Garlic Chicken Balls

Recipe is very simple. Minced chicken is flavored with garlic, onion and herbs. Pepper powder and red chili flakes for that kick. If you like spicy chicken balls use extra red chili flakes for extra kick. Make balls. Stuff small cubes of Mozzarella.

Coat in bread crumb. Use panko bread crumbs if you are after extra crispy crunchy chicken balls.

Serving Sauce

Almost all sauce can be used to pair with this cheesy garlic chicken balls. Spicy marinara sauce, spicy mayo sauce, even plain ketchup is a hit combo with my kids. I served with spicy mint sauce/chutney to go with these chicken balls.

The recipe for spicy mint sauce is very easy. 1 cup mint leaves + 2 cloves garlic + 1 green chili + 1 tablespoon lemon juice + salt and ½ teaspoon water. Grind all together into thick sauce.

Can You Reheat Chicken Cheese Balls?

Yes. I have tested freezing these chicken balls. And before serving I reheated in oven. Turned out really good. There was a crunch on it. However, frozen chicken balls when reheated in microwave turned out to be less crunchy. So i recommend you to reheat it in oven only.

Cheesy Garlic Chicken Balls

Jyothi Rajesh

Cheesy garlic chicken balls are easy to make, can be baked as well. Can be served as a snack or appetizer. Plus these chicken balls freezes great!

Prep Time 15 minutes mins

Cook Time 15 minutes mins

Total Time 30 minutes mins

Course Starters

Cuisine American

Servings 6 people

Calories 240

Ingredients

  • 1 lb minced chicken
  • 1 tablespoon onion powder
  • 3 cloves of garlic minced
  • Salt to taste
  • 1 tablespoon pepper powder
  • 2 teaspoon oregano
  • 1 teaspoon red chili flakes
  • Oil for deep frying
  • Mozzarella cheese cubes for stuffing

For coating

  • ½ cup all purpose flour
  • 2 eggs beaten
  • ¾ cup bread crumbs

Instructions

  • In a wide bowl add minced chicken, onion powder, minced garlic, pepper powder, oregano, red chili flakes, salt to taste and mix well.

  • In a wide pan heat oil for deep frying.

  • Make lemon sized balls of the chicken mix. Place a small cube of mozzarella cheese in the center and roll well into neat balls.

  • Coat the chicken balls with all purpose flour first, then dip it in eggs and finally coat bread crumbs. Repeat this step for all chicken mix.

  • Once oil turns hot, reduce heat to medium. Drop the rolled balls 2 to 3 at a time and deep fry until golden brown. Remove from oil and drain it on kitchen towel.

  • Serve immediately with any dipping sauce of your choice. These are great finger party food.

Notes

  1. These are great to freeze. You can freeze the chicken balls before frying. Coat the chicken balls in bread crumbs and place them in zip lock bag and freeze. Can be frozen for upto a month.
  2. The fried balls can also be frozen. You can take them out of the freezer and warm it in oven. Let me remind, reheated chicken balls in microwave might not be as crispy as you can expect when it's just fried. SO I recommend you to reheat in oven.
